Output 20f3fe248ba096357b56235a66e817d6cbb50de78b81b91a3a67bee6faa27a4a:1

value
509015
script pubkey
OP_0 OP_PUSHBYTES_20 8de5d46c1b1a1c9fb41632f41e162da51867568c
address
bc1q3hjagmqmrgwfldqkxt6pu93d55vxw45vsushap
transaction
20f3fe248ba096357b56235a66e817d6cbb50de78b81b91a3a67bee6faa27a4a
spent
true